Output 95cbdb33efcf0fd20f33d0325f66d4e342a5c97b64b9a8c70934d4d41518842b:3

value
34060593
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53544731c1f22dc70e009e57a65c1101a4f83517 OP_EQUALVERIFY OP_CHECKSIG
address
18bc3fhPaWaF8EgpmArwqf3MoJEYrH359Q
transaction
95cbdb33efcf0fd20f33d0325f66d4e342a5c97b64b9a8c70934d4d41518842b
spent
true